Revitalize Your Space: A Comprehensive Guide to Bifold Door Handle Replacement
Bifold doors, likewise referred to as folding doors, are a great space-saving service for closets, pantries, laundry spaces, and even as space dividers. Their ability to neatly fold away permits broader openings while lessening the door swing radius, making them perfect for areas where area is at a premium. A vital, yet often neglected, part of these doors is the manage. Similar to any other hardware, bifold door manages can end up being worn, harmed, or simply outdated with time. A damaged or unsightly handle can not only interfere with the visual appeal of your doors but likewise prevent their performance.

Luckily, changing a bifold door handle is an uncomplicated DIY job that can breathe brand-new life into your doors, boosting both their appearance and ease of usage. This post will assist you through the procedure of bifold door handle replacement, providing you with all the details you need to tackle this task with confidence, from understanding different manage types to mastering the installation procedure.

1. Eliminating the Old Handle:
Identify the Screw Locations: Examine your existing bifold door handle. You will typically find screws on the within the deal with, typically hidden under a cap or cover plate.Get Rid Of Cover Plate (if relevant): If your manage has a cover plate or cap concealing the screws, carefully remove it. This might involve gently spying it off with a little flathead screwdriver or merely moving it off.Unscrew and Remove the Old Handle: Using the suitable screwdriver, carefully unscrew the screws holding the deal with in place. Turn the screwdriver counter-clockwise to loosen and get rid of the screws. Keep the screws in a safe place if you might require to reuse them. As you loosen the last screw, hold the handle securely to avoid it from falling. As soon as all screws are eliminated, carefully pull the old manage away from the door.

4. Fixing (If Necessary):
Screws Too Loose: If the manage feels loose after tightening the screws, check if the screws are the proper length and size. You may require somewhat longer or thicker screws to ensure a safe and secure fit. If the screw holes are removed and will not hold screws, you might need to use wood filler to reinforce the holes and then re-drill pilot holes.Screws Too Tight/Stripped: If you overtighten the screws and strip the screw holes in the door, you will need to repair the holes before reinstalling the manage. Wood filler or toothpicks and wood glue can be used to fill stripped holes. As soon as the filler is dry, pre-drill brand-new pilot holes and carefully re-install the screws.Manage Doesn't Align: If the brand-new handle's screw holes do not line up with the existing holes, you may require to somewhat adjust the handle's position. If the misalignments are minor, you can sometimes thoroughly expand the existing holes in the handle using a drill bit somewhat larger than the screw diameter. Be cautious not to make the holes too large. Q: Can I replace a bifold door handle myself?A: Yes, changing a bifold door handle is normally a simple DIY job that many property owners can accomplish with basic tools and very little experience.

Q: What tools do I need to replace a bifold door handle?A: Usually, you will only require a screwdriver (often Phillips head), and possibly a pencil and measuring tape. A drill may be needed in uncommon cases.

Q: How long does it require to replace a bifold door manage?A: The whole process needs to take just about 10-20 minutes, depending upon your experience level and if any minor modifications are needed.

Q: Where can I buy replacement bifold door deals with?A: Replacement bifold door deals with are readily offered at many home enhancement stores, hardware stores, and online sellers.

Q: My old handle was glued on, not screwed. How do I remove it?A: If your manage is glued on, you might need to carefully utilize an utility knife or putty knife to carefully score around the edges of the handle to break the adhesive seal. You may likewise utilize a hairdryer to carefully heat the manage to soften the adhesive, making it easier to get rid of. Beware not to damage the door surface area.

Q: Do all bifold door handles have the same screw hole spacing?A: No, screw hole spacing can differ somewhat in between various manage styles and manufacturers. It's a good idea to measure the screw hole spacing on your old manage and look for a replacement with comparable spacing, or guarantee the brand-new manage's installing plate covers the old holes even if the spacing is slightly various.
